use clap::{ArgAction, Args};
use super::QueuedCommand;
#[derive(Debug, Clone, Args)]
pub(crate) struct DisplayMessageArgs {
#[arg(short = 'c', allow_hyphen_values = true)]
pub(crate) target_client: Option<String>,
#[arg(short = 't', allow_hyphen_values = true)]
pub(crate) target: Option<String>,
#[arg(short = 'd', allow_hyphen_values = true)]
pub(crate) delay: Option<String>,
#[arg(short = 'F', allow_hyphen_values = true)]
pub(crate) format: Option<String>,
#[arg(short = 'a', action = ArgAction::SetTrue, conflicts_with = "json")]
pub(crate) all_formats: bool,
#[arg(short = 'C', action = ArgAction::SetTrue)]
pub(crate) no_freeze: bool,
#[arg(short = 'I', action = ArgAction::SetTrue, conflicts_with = "json")]
pub(crate) stdin: bool,
#[arg(short = 'l', action = ArgAction::SetTrue, conflicts_with = "json")]
pub(crate) literal: bool,
#[arg(short = 'N', action = ArgAction::SetTrue)]
pub(crate) ignore_input: bool,
#[arg(short = 'p', action = ArgAction::SetTrue, conflicts_with = "json")]
pub(crate) print: bool,
#[arg(short = 'v', action = ArgAction::SetTrue, conflicts_with = "json")]
pub(crate) verbose: bool,
#[arg(long = "json", action = ArgAction::SetTrue)]
pub(crate) json: bool,
#[arg(allow_hyphen_values = true, trailing_var_arg = true)]
pub(crate) message: Vec<String>,
#[arg(skip = String::new())]
pub(crate) queue_command: String,
}
impl QueuedCommand for DisplayMessageArgs {
fn set_queue_command(&mut self, queue_command: String) {
self.queue_command = queue_command;
}
}
impl DisplayMessageArgs {
pub(crate) fn validate(self) -> Result<Self, clap::Error> {
if let Some(delay) = self.delay.as_deref() {
delay
.parse::<rmux_proto::DisplayMessageDurationMillis>()
.map_err(|error| {
clap::Error::raw(clap::error::ErrorKind::InvalidValue, error.to_string())
})?;
}
if self.message.len() > 1 {
return Err(clap::Error::raw(
clap::error::ErrorKind::TooManyValues,
"command display-message: too many arguments (need at most 1)",
));
}
Ok(self)
}
}
